當您想要在矩陣和圖表中顯示相同的數據時,您必須在兩個數據區上設定屬性來指定相同的數據集,以及篩選、群組、排序和數據相同的表達式。
由於這兩個數據區域的數據上階(報表數據集)相同,您可以將互動式排序按鈕新增至矩陣,當使用者按一下時,會變更矩陣和圖表的排序順序。 如需詳細資訊,請參閱將互動式排序新增至數據表或矩陣(報表產生器及 SSRS)。
若要將矩陣欄群組值用作圖表的圖例,您必須指定圖表上系列資料的顏色,然後使用相同的顏色作為矩陣單元格中顯示群組值的文字框背景填滿色。 如需詳細資訊,請參閱跨多個圖形圖表指定一致的色彩(報表產生器及 SSRS)。
在運行時間,如果您的群組定義有太多群組值,您的報表可能會顯得雜亂無章。 您可能需要篩選值、合併群組,或調整圖表的臨界值,以為您合併群組。 如需詳細資訊,請參閱 將多個數據區連結至相同的數據集(報表產生器及 SSRS)
備註
您可以在報表產生器及 SQL Server Data Tools 的報表設計師中建立和修改報表定義 (.rdl)。 每個撰寫環境提供不同的方式來建立、開啟及儲存報表和相關專案。 如需詳細資訊,請至 microsoft.com 網站上查看 報表設計師和報表產生器 (SSRS) 的報表設計。
若要新增矩陣和圖表以顯示相同的數據
在設計檢視中開啟報表。
在 [ 插入] 索引標籤的 [ 數據區 ] 群組中,按兩下 [ 矩陣],然後按兩下報表主體或報表主體中的矩形。 矩陣會新增至報表。
在 [ 插入] 索引標籤的 [ 數據區 ] 群組中,按兩下 [ 圖表],然後選取圖表類型。 圖表會新增至報表。
(選擇性)在 插入 索引標籤的 報表專案 群組中,按一下 矩形,然後按一下報表。 矩形會新增至報表。 將矩陣和圖表從步驟 2 和 3 拖曳到矩形。
藉由將多個數據區放在矩形容器中,您可以協助控制在檢視報表時矩陣和圖表呈現的方式。
在接下來的幾個步驟中,您將選擇同一個數據集欄位以顯示在矩陣和圖表中。
從 [報表數據] 窗格中,將數值數據集欄位拖曳至矩陣中的數據格。
根據預設,聚合函數 Sum 用於計算群組值。 如果您變更矩陣中的聚合函數,也必須在圖表中變更。
在矩陣中,以滑鼠右鍵單擊具有數據的儲存格,單擊 文字框屬性,然後單擊 數字。 為數據集域值選擇適當的格式。
按一下 [確定]。
將您在步驟 3 中選擇的相同數據集欄位拖曳至圖表上的 [值 ] 區域。
在圖表中,以滑鼠右鍵按兩下Y軸,按兩下 [ 軸屬性],然後按兩下 [ 數位]。 針對您在步驟 4 中選擇的數據,選擇相同的格式。
按一下 [確定]。
在接下來的幾個步驟中,您會將矩陣數據列群組和圖表數位列群組設定為相同的運算式,同時設定圖表數列群組的排序順序。
從 [報表數據] 窗格中,將您要針對矩陣數據列分組的數據集欄位拖曳至 [數據列群組] 窗格。
根據預設,矩陣數據列群組會新增與群組表達式相同的排序表達式。
將您在步驟 9 中使用的相同資料集欄位拖曳至圖表的 [ 數列群組 ] 區域。
以滑鼠右鍵按兩下 [ 數列群組 ] 區域中的群組,然後按兩下 [ 數列群組屬性]。
按兩下 [排序]。
按下 新增。 排序表達式方格中會出現新的數據列。
在 [排序依據] 的下拉式清單中,選擇您在步驟 9 中選擇分組依據的數據集字段。
按一下 [確定]。
在接下來的幾個步驟中,您會將矩陣數據行群組和圖表類別目錄群組設定為相同的表達式,同時設定圖表類別目錄群組的排序順序。
從 [報表數據] 窗格中,將您要針對矩陣數據行分組的數據集欄位拖曳至 [數據行群組] 窗格。
根據預設,矩陣數據行群組會新增與群組表達式相同的排序表達式。
將您在步驟 16 中使用的相同資料集欄位拖曳至圖表的 [類別群組 ] 區域。
以滑鼠右鍵按兩下 CategoryGroups 區域中的 群組,然後按兩下 [類別群組屬性]。
按兩下 [排序]。
按下 新增。 排序表達式方格中會出現新的數據列。
在 [排序依據] 的下拉式清單中,選擇您在步驟 16 中選擇分組依據的數據集字段。
按一下 [確定]。
預覽結果。 矩陣數據列和數據行群組會顯示與圖表數位和類別群組相同的數據。
另請參閱
將多個資料區域連結至相同的資料集(報表產生器及 SSRS)
新增資料組篩選、資料區篩選和群組篩選 (報表產生器及 SSRS)
清單(報表產生器及 SSRS)
圖表(報表產生器及 SSRS)